## Changelog — Ticktrace 1.9

### Renamed: DRIFT_API_TOKEN
During the cron drift investigation we found plugins confusing this variable with the metrics token, so it has been renamed to indicate it authorizes drift-report uploads specifically. Plugin authors must read the new name from 1.9 onward; the old name is ignored without warning. Sample env files in the SDK are updated. In your deployment env file, the drift-report upload secret is set on the next line.

env line for fawef-taguf: VAULT_KEY13=a9695905a9a90

**Ticket: GALE-412 — Fan-out workers dropping DB connections**

Since Tuesday's deploy, the StormRelay fan-out workers hit connection resets roughly every 40 minutes under load. Alert delivery lags by up to 6 minutes during spikes. Pool exhaustion suspected — max connections on the replica look too low for 12 workers. Mira bumped pool size to 50; no change. Need decision at sync: scale replica or shard the fan-out queue. To reproduce, point a worker at the staging replica using the string below.

primary connection of tajeg-tajop = postgresql://julax_svc:DI@db-e7f3.kelvidyn.corp:5432/rusdor

Ticket: SproutCycle scheduler skipping watering windows on the Fernhollow node. Investigation shows the staging .env was copied to production without updating the timezone offset, so the scheduler fires six hours late. On-call: stop the cron runner, correct SPROUT_TZ, and verify the next three windows in the dry-run log before re-enabling. While the file is open, add the weather-API secret on the line directly beneath.

sealed setting: VAULT_KEY20=c8ea1e419912889df6b4

Welcome to the Pellwick Mobile team. As a contractor on CrashFunnel, our crash-report pipeline, you'll triage symbolicated reports flowing from the Dorsten ingest tier into the dedupe queue. Please read the retention policy before touching raw payloads, since they may contain device state. To access the symbol-server vault during your first week, you'll authenticate through the bastion and then unseal the store. The unseal step requires the recovery passphrase below.

vault phrase of bagaf-kajeg = jorath-feniel-briir-siliel-ralix